Sourced from the unique Duvarita Vineyard, located just west of the Sta. Rita Hills AVA, this Chardonnay thrives in a cool, maritime-influenced microclimate defined by ancient, windblown sandy soils. The challenging terroir forces the vines to dig deep, resulting in low yields of intensely concentrated fruit. Named 'Belle de Jour'—a nod to both the radiant daylily and classic French cinema—this cuvée is crafted by Paul Lato with minimal intervention. Fermented and aged in select French oak barrels, it beautifully marries vibrant, electric acidity with a luxurious, textured mouthfeel, capturing the pure, saline-tinged essence of its coastal origin.

Founded in 2002 by Polish-born sommelier Paul Lato, this artisanal winery is based in Santa Maria, California, within the heart of Santa Barbara County. Driven by a philosophy of minimal intervention and a quest for elegance and balance, Lato meticulously selects fruit from some of the Central Coast's most prestigious vineyards, including Bien Nacido, Solomon Hills, and Larner. The estate is highly acclaimed for its small-production, single-vineyard Pinot Noirs, Chardonnays, and Syrahs, which beautifully capture the unique maritime-influenced terroir of the region. With an unwavering focus on purity of fruit and texture, expressions like the Solomon Hills Pinot Noir Suerte and Larner Syrah Cinematique have earned the winery a reputation as one of California's premier boutique producers.
